WebExamples of inductive arguments 1. The grouper is a fish, it has scales and breathes through its gills. The sardine is a fish, it has scales and breathes through its gills. The shark is a fish, it has scales and breathes through its gills. Probably all fish have scales and breathe through their gills. 2. The snake is a reptile and has no hair. An inductive argument is one in which the conclusion is reached by considering a number of specific examples or observations.
